网页,作为我们与互联网交互的主要媒介,可以大致分为两种类型:静态网页和动态网页。虽然它们看起来可能相似,但它们的内部运作却截然不同,形成了截然不同的用户体验。
静态网页:简单而稳定
静态网页就像一张永恒不变的画布,加载时一次性从服务器获取所有内容。它们通常由 HTML(超文本标记语言)和 CSS(层叠样式表)等基本技术组成,具有以下特点:
- 加载速度快:由于内容自始至终都不变,因此静态网页通常加载非常迅速。
- 稳定性高:静态网页不受用户交互或数据库查询的影响,因此非常稳定和可靠。
- 有限的功能:静态网页的交互性有限,主要通过链接和表单提供导航和数据收集功能。
- 维护简单:更新静态网页只涉及修改 HTML 和 CSS 文件,因此维护起来相当容易。
动态网页:交互性和灵活性
动态网页则像一个活生生的有机体,针对每个用户请求实时生成内容。它们利用编程语言(如 PHP、JavaScript 和 Python)和数据库(如 MySQL、PostgreSQL)来实现交互性和数据动态性。动态网页的特点如下:
- 交互性强:用户可以通过表单、按钮和下拉菜单与动态网页进行交互,实现实时反馈和信息交换。
- 内容动态:动态网页的内容可以根据用户输入、数据库查询或其他外部因素进行调整和更新。
- 功能丰富:动态网页可以实现复杂的应用程序功能,例如购物、银行和社交媒体互动。
- 加载速度稍慢:由于需要实时生成内容,动态网页的加载速度通常比静态网页慢一些。
技术对比:服务器端与客户端
静态网页主要在服务器端处理,而动态网页则依赖于服务器端和客户端的共同努力。
- 静态网页:服务器将完整页面发送到客户端浏览器,无需进一步处理。
- 动态网页:服务器接收客户端请求,运行脚本生成动态内容,然后将该内容发送回客户端浏览器,由后者进行最终渲染。
选择哪种网页类型:由目的驱动
选择静态网页还是动态网页取决于您网站的具体目标和要求。
- 静态网页适合:展示性网站、博客、简单的在线商店和小型个人网站。
- 动态网页适合:电子商务网站、社交网络、基于数据的应用程序和需要高度交互性的网站。
结论
静态网页和动态网页都是网页设计中的重要工具,各有其优势和局限性。通过了解它们之间的区别,您可以根据您的特定需求做出明智的选择。无论您是需要一个简单的信息平台还是一个复杂的交互式应用程序,网页技术的不断发展都能满足您的需求。
嗨,大家好!今天,我将带大家一探静态网页和动态网页之间的奥秘。虽然它们都是网络世界的成员,但它们可是有着天壤之别哦!
静态网页:简单易懂的“橱窗”
想象一下一个实体商店的橱窗。它展示着商品,让你一览无余。静态网页就像这个橱窗,展示的是固定的内容,不会随着用户的互动而改变。
静态网页通常使用HTML(超文本标记语言)编写。它们是预先制作好的,一旦上传到网络上就保持不变。因此,它们加载速度快,而且对移动设备友好。
动态网页:交互式体验的“游乐场”
现在,让我们把目光转向游乐场。充满活力,各种游乐设施任你玩耍。动态网页就像这个游乐场,提供交互式体验,可以随着用户的输入而改变。
动态网页通常使用PHP、Python或JavaScript等编程语言创建。它们与数据库连接,可以实时获取和更新信息。这意味着它们可以响应用户的操作,提供个性化体验,例如登录、购物车和实时更新。
关键区别:
- 内容可变性:静态网页的内容是固定的,而动态网页的内容可以动态改变。
- 用户交互:静态网页不支持用户交互,而动态网页可以通过表单、按钮和菜单提供交互式体验。
- 数据访问:静态网页无法访问数据库,而动态网页可以通过编程语言连接到数据库。
- 响应性:静态网页通常对移动设备友好,而动态网页可以提供针对不同设备量身定制的响应式体验。
- 复杂性:静态网页相对简单易于创建,而动态网页需要更高的编程技能。
优缺点:
静态网页:
- 优点:加载速度快、对移动设备友好、简单易用
- 缺点:内容不可变、交互性有限
动态网页:
- 优点:交互式体验、个性化内容、数据访问能力
- 缺点:加载速度可能较慢、需要较高的编程技能
选择哪种类型?
选择哪种类型取决于你的特定需求。对于展示简单信息或提供基本浏览体验的网站,静态网页可能就足够了。对于需要交互式功能、个性化内容或访问数据库的网站,动态网页是更好的选择。
总之,静态网页和动态网页都是网络世界的宝贵工具。通过了解它们之间的区别,你可以做出明智的决定,选择最适合你需求的类型。
无论你是网站设计的新手还是经验丰富的专业人士,深入理解静态网页和动态网页之间的差异都会让你如虎添翼。它将使你能够创建满足用户需求并有效传达信息的强大网站。
作为一名网页开发者,对于静态网页和动态网页的区别,我可是门儿清。这两者在技术层面和用户体验上都有着显著的差异,接下来我就来好好和你说道说道。
静态网页
静态网页就好比一本印刷的书,内容是一成不变的,就像书中的文字和图片。它们使用HTML(超文本标记语言)编写,是一种标记语言,用于定义网页的结构和内容。
静态网页的优势在于:
- 速度快:由于内容固定,加载速度快,用户可以快速访问信息。
- 简单易维护:只要修改HTML文件,就可以更新网页内容,即使是新手也能轻松上手。
- 安全性高:没有服务器端代码,不易受到黑客攻击。
动态网页
动态网页则更像一个互动平台,可以随着用户输入或操作而改变内容。它们使用诸如PHP、JavaScript和ASP.NET等服务器端脚本语言编写,这些语言可以动态生成HTML响应。
动态网页的优势包括:
- 交互性强:用户可以通过表单、按钮和菜单进行交互,实现诸如注册、搜索和购物等功能。
- 个性化:根据用户的偏好或数据,提供个性化的内容和体验,如推荐商品或定制新闻。
- 实时性:可以实时更新内容,如聊天室或股票行情。
技术上的区别
静态网页服务器只负责传递预先准备好的文件,而动态网页服务器则需要处理用户请求,执行服务器端代码,然后再生成HTML响应。
静态网页通常使用文件扩展名”.html”或”.htm”,而动态网页使用”.php”、”.asp”或”.aspx”等扩展名。
用户体验上的区别
对于用户来说,静态网页通常提供的信息更加有限,而动态网页则更具交互性和动态性。
静态网页适合于内容相对固定且不需要交互的场景,如产品说明页或联系信息。动态网页则适合于需要用户输入、交互或实时更新内容的场景,如电子商务网站或新闻动态。
哪种类型适合你?
选择静态网页还是动态网页取决于你网站的具体需求和目标。
- 如果你的网站需要提供固定且简单的信息,并且交互性不高,那么静态网页就足够了。
- 如果你的网站需要交互性、个性化或实时更新,那么动态网页是必不可少的。
小结
静态网页和动态网页是两种不同的技术,各有其优缺点。了解它们之间的差异至关重要,这样才能根据自己的需求选择最合适的类型,从而创建高性能、用户友好的网站。